Appetizers
The appetizers at Bird’s Nest set the tone for your meal. Each dish is prepared with care, offering a balance of textures and flavors.
From crispy fried delights to light and refreshing starters, the appetizers are perfect for sharing or enjoying solo.
Dish |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
Spring Rolls (4 pcs) | Crispy rolls filled with fresh vegetables and vermicelli noodles, served with a sweet chili dipping sauce. | $7.95 |
Crab Rangoon | Fried wontons stuffed with cream cheese and crab meat, accented with scallions and served with a tangy sauce. | $8.50 |
Potstickers (6 pcs) | Pan-fried dumplings filled with seasoned pork and vegetables, served with soy-based dipping sauce. | $9.25 |
Edamame | Steamed young soybeans lightly salted, a healthy and satisfying starter. | $5.50 |
Chicken Satay | Grilled marinated chicken skewers served with a creamy peanut sauce. | $9.95 |

Main Courses
The main course selection at Bird’s Nest is extensive and varied. Diners can choose from classic Chinese dishes, noodle specialties, and chef’s signature plates.
The focus remains on authentic taste and well-balanced ingredients.
Chef’s Specials
Dish |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
General Tso’s Chicken | Crispy chicken pieces tossed in a sweet and spicy sauce with broccoli and bell peppers. | $16.95 |
Beef and Broccoli | Tender beef stir-fried with fresh broccoli in a savory garlic sauce. | $17.50 |
Kung Pao Shrimp | Spicy shrimp stir-fried with peanuts, chili peppers, and vegetables. | $18.95 |
Mapo Tofu | Soft tofu and ground pork cooked in a spicy bean paste sauce, served with steamed rice. | $15.75 |
Sweet and Sour Pork | Lightly battered pork pieces served with pineapple, bell peppers, and a tangy sauce. | $16.50 |
Noodle & Rice Dishes
Bird’s Nest offers a variety of noodle and rice dishes that highlight the versatility of Asian cuisine. These dishes are hearty, flavorful, and perfect for those looking for a filling meal.
Dish |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
Chow Mein | Stir-fried noodles with vegetables and a choice of chicken, beef, or shrimp. | $14.95 |
Pad Thai | Traditional Thai rice noodles with tamarind sauce, peanuts, eggs, and bean sprouts. | $15.95 |
Fried Rice | Classic fried rice with eggs, vegetables, and choice of meat or tofu. | $13.95 |
Lo Mein | Soft egg noodles stir-fried with mixed vegetables and your choice of protein. | $14.50 |
Singapore Noodles | Curried rice vermicelli stir-fried with shrimp, pork, and vegetables. | $16.25 |
Vegetarian & Vegan Options
Bird’s Nest is committed to accommodating diverse dietary preferences. The vegetarian and vegan dishes are prepared with fresh vegetables, tofu, and flavorful sauces.
These options are not only healthy but also rich in authentic taste.
Dish |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
Vegetable Stir Fry | Seasonal vegetables stir-fried in a light garlic sauce, served with steamed rice. | $13.95 |
Tofu with Black Bean Sauce | Soft tofu cooked with fermented black beans and vegetables. | $14.50 |
Vegan Pad Thai | Rice noodles stir-fried with tofu, peanuts, and vegetables in tamarind sauce. | $15.95 |
Eggplant in Garlic Sauce | Spicy sautéed eggplant with garlic and chili, served hot. | $14.75 |
Desserts
End your dining experience with a sweet treat from the Bird’s Nest dessert menu. These dishes offer a perfect balance of traditional Asian sweets and familiar favorites.
Dessert |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
Mango Sticky Rice | Sweet sticky rice topped with ripe mango slices and coconut milk. | $7.95 |
Fried Banana with Honey | Crispy fried banana drizzled with honey, served warm. | $6.50 |
Green Tea Ice Cream | Creamy green tea flavored ice cream, a refreshing finish. | $5.95 |
Red Bean Cake | Soft cake filled with sweet red bean paste, a traditional delicacy. | $6.75 |

Beverages
Bird’s Nest offers a selection of beverages to complement your meal. From traditional teas to soft drinks and specialty cocktails, there is something for everyone.
Beverage |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
Jasmine Tea | Fragrant and soothing hot jasmine tea, perfect to start or end your meal. | $3.50 |
Bubble Tea | Classic milk tea with tapioca pearls; available in various flavors. | $5.95 |
Thai Iced Tea | Sweet and creamy iced tea with a hint of spices. | $4.50 |
Soft Drinks | Assorted sodas including cola, lemon-lime, and ginger ale. | $2.95 |
Sake (Hot or Cold) | Traditional Japanese rice wine, served warm or chilled. | $8.00 |
